The Marsden motion template with signature is a legal document used by defendants to request the appointment of new counsel when they believe their current attorney has provided inadequate or incompetent representation. This template allows the defendant to clearly outline their reasons for seeking a new attorney, typically due to conflicts or perceived ineffectiveness. It includes spaces for all necessary information, such as the names of the defendant and attorney, as well as a certificate of service for notifying the current attorney. To fill out this form, users should provide detailed factual statements supporting their motion and ensure that their respective signatures are included. To prove ineffective assistance of counsel, a defendant must show: That their trial lawyer's conduct fell below an "objective standard of reasonableness" and, "a reasonable probability that, but for counsel's unprofessional errors,? the outcome of the criminal proceeding would have been different.

A Marsden Motion is a request by a criminal defendant to fire his or her appointed public defender and acquire new representation. The defendant must show that the appointed attorney is not providing adequate representation, or the attorney has a conflict with the defendant.

Real case examples of ineffective assistance of counsel are: defense counsel not objecting to the use of the defendant's incriminating statement, defense lawyer not objecting to errors in a presentence report, defense attorney failing to object to the excessive length of the defendant's sentence, 11 and.

A defendant can make a Marsden motion by an oral motion before the trial judge; although a formal motion is not required, the defendant must clearly indicate that he/she wants a substitution of attorney. DO I QUALIFY TO MAKE A MARSDEN MOTION? You must currently have a court appointed attorney to qualify.
